Techaroundworld.com
Home
Companies
Contact
Open main menu
Home
Companies
Contact
Home
Companies
Sephora company
Jobs at Sephora company
Asset Protection Partner
Sephora company
Oakville
17 hours ago
Stage Experience Manager, Stores
Sephora company
Calgary
$2 - $4
22 days ago